There are several good references on line for learning JSTL, but I have found the actual spec itself to be great.
I'm assuming you want something like <br>AAA/BBB/CCC<br>DDD/EEE/FFF etc... <c:forEach var="v" items="${vectors}"> <br> <c:forEach var="seriesCat" items="${v}" varStatus="status"> <c:if test="${!status.first}">/</c:if> <c:out value="$(seriesCat}"/> </c:forEach> </c:forEach> To avoid the first <br>, use the same logic as the inner loop: <c:forEach var="v" items="${vectors}" varStatus="outerStatus"> <c:if test="${!outerStatus.first}"><br></c:if> <c:forEach var="seriesCat" items="${v}" varStatus="status"> <c:if test="${!status.first}">/</c:if> <c:out value="$(seriesCat}"/> </c:forEach> </c:forEach> should produce something like: AAA/BBB/CCC<br>DDD/EEE/FFF etc... BTW, this code is untested, but it should work. robert > -----Original Message----- > From: Dean A.
